It is possible to design both loft and bunk beds with safety in mind. A lot of them have guard rails around their top sleeping area, which helps prevent young children from falling and tumbling. It is best to wait until your child is more than 6 years old before purchasing loft beds or a bunk bed. They will understand the rules and rules (no jumping is the very first rule!). UK guidelines recommend that the top bunk of an L-shaped or bunk single bed should only be used by children of six years or above. However, if you think that your children could be trusted with sleeping up in the bunk from a young age, then it's definitely possible to let them do so.
